Does a Normal Frame Rate Make Billy Lynn a Better Movie? by Jackson McHenry

Unless you live near one of the five theaters in the world that are currently equipped to show Billy Lynn's Long Halftime Walk in 120 frames per second, 4k resolution, and 3-D, you won't see the film in the format director Ang Lee intended.
